@ -0,0 +1,34 @@
using NewHorizons.Utility;
namespace NewHorizons.External
{
public class ShipLogModule : Module
{
public string xmlFile;
public string spriteFolder;
public MapMode mapMode;
public CuriosityColor[] curiosities;
public EntryPosition[] positions;
public class MapMode
{
public string revealedSprite;
public string outlineSprite;
public float scale;
public bool invisibleWhenHidden;
}
public class CuriosityColor
{
public string id;
public MColor color;
public MColor highlightColor;
}
public class EntryPosition
{
public string id;
public MVector2 position;
}
}
}

@ -0,0 +1,26 @@
using UnityEngine;
namespace NewHorizons.Utility
{
public class MVector2
{
public MVector2(float x, float y)
{
X = x;
Y = y;
}
public float X { get; }
public float Y { get; }
public static implicit operator MVector2(Vector2 vec)
{
return new MVector2(vec.x, vec.y);
}
public static implicit operator Vector2(MVector2 vec)
{
return new Vector2(vec.X, vec.Y);
}
}
}
